How Curioz Works

Curioz is not just another smart speaker; it’s a thoughtfully designed educational tool that prioritizes intuitive and interactive learning experiences. The speaker features a central button surrounded by a soft-glowing LED ring that changes color depending on whether the AI is listening, thinking, or responding. This design ensures a calm and intuitive user experience, fostering genuine curiosity in children.

Curioz Modes: Tailored to the Whole Family

Curioz offers two distinct modes—Curioz Kids and Curioz Parents—adapting its responses to suit the user’s age and curiosity level. In the Curioz Kids mode, the AI is finely tuned for children around 8 years old, providing short, playful answers and always ending with a gentle prompt like “Would you like to know more?” This approach encourages deeper learning without overloading young minds.

The Curioz Parents mode, on the other hand, offers more nuanced answers, making it a perfect tool for family learning sessions where adults can participate and guide discussions.
